Understanding Sodium-Ion Battery Technology
The recent advancements in sodium-ion battery technology have sparked significant interest, especially with the introduction of the 12V 200Ah sodium-ion battery. This innovative technology presents exciting possibilities for energy storage solutions. Step 1: Recognizing the Benefits of Sodium-Ion Batteries
Identify the advantages of using sodium-ion batteries compared to other battery technologies. - Sodium-ion batteries utilize abundant and inexpensive sodium, making them potentially cheaper and more environmentally friendly than lithium-ion alternatives. - They offer comparable energy density and charge/discharge cycles, which makes them suitable for a variety of applications, including renewable energy storage and electric vehicles. Appropriate for individuals and businesses looking to invest in sustainable energy solutions.Step 2: Evaluating Use Cases
Consider how the 12V 200Ah sodium-ion battery can be integrated into your energy systems. - This battery can efficiently power electric bikes, marine applications, or even act as backup power in homes. - Check if your current system is compatible with the unique specifications of the sodium-ion battery and whether it can replace existing lithium batteries without significant modifications.
